The FIFA World Cup 26™ CONMEBOL Qualifiers saw an intense clash between the Chile Republic National Football Team and the Bolivia National Football Team. The highly anticipated match took place on 11th September 2024, at Estadio Nacional Julio Martínez Prádanos in Santiago, Chile. With both teams looking to kick off their campaign strongly, fans were in for a thrilling encounter in this Round One fixture. Chile came into the match under pressure, following a recent streak of mixed results, while Bolivia looked to capitalize on their positive momentum.

Chile Republic National Football Team vs Bolivia National Football Team First Half: A Shocking Turn of Events
The match started with both teams vying for early control. Bolivia stunned the home crowd by opening the scoring in the 13th minute through Carmelo Algarañaz, who calmly finished off a well-executed pass from Roberto Fernandez. Chile, now trailing, responded aggressively, pressing Bolivia’s defense. Their persistence paid off in the 39th minute when Eduardo Vargas scored the equalizer, a crucial moment that reignited the Chilean side. However, Bolivia had other plans, as Miguel Terceros slotted in a goal in the first-half stoppage time, sending Bolivia into the break with a 2-1 lead.
First-Half Score:
- Chile 1-2 Bolivia
Chile Republic National Football Team vs Bolivia National Football Team Second Half: A Tactical Battle
Chile, facing a deficit, came out with intent in the second half, making key substitutions with Vicente Pizarro and Jean Meneses entering the field. Despite continuous efforts to find another equalizer, including multiple attempts by Eduardo Vargas and Gonzalo Tapia, Bolivia’s defense held strong. Chile had several chances but were denied either by solid goalkeeping from Guillermo Vizcarra or by Bolivia’s resolute defending. The Bolivians, on the other hand, managed the game well, using tactical fouls and slowing the tempo when necessary.
As the match progressed into stoppage time, tensions flared, resulting in multiple yellow cards. Despite Chile’s late pushes, including a corner in the 90’+8 minute, Bolivia held on to their lead, securing a vital 2-1 win.

Chile Republic National Football Team vs Bolivia National Football Team Impact on the Points Table:
Bolivia’s impressive 2-1 away victory against Chile boosted their position in the FIFA World Cup 26™ CONMEBOL Qualifiers standings. With this win, Bolivia moved closer to the automatic qualification spots, while Chile’s loss pushed them further down the table, increasing the pressure on the Chile Republic National Football Team to secure wins in upcoming matches.
Man of the Match:
Miguel Terceros (Bolivia) was awarded the Man of the Match for his outstanding performance. His goal at a crucial moment and involvement in Bolivia’s attacking plays made him the standout player of the game.
